当前位置: 首页>前端>正文

axios还可以用来加载js

使用axios加载js文件

在前端开发中,我们经常会使用axios来进行ajax请求,从服务器获取数据。但是你可能不知道,其实axios还可以用来加载js文件。本文将介绍如何使用axios加载js文件,并提供一个简单的示例。

使用axios加载js文件的方法

在axios中,我们可以使用axios.get方法来加载js文件。当我们获取到js文件后,我们可以通过动态创建script标签的方式来执行这个js文件。

以下是如何使用axios加载js文件的步骤:

步骤一:使用axios加载js文件

首先,我们使用axios发送一个get请求来获取js文件。

```javascript
axios.get('
  .then(response => {
    // 获取到js文件后执行下一步操作
  })
  .catch(error => {
    console.error('加载js文件失败', error);
  });

### 步骤二:执行加载的js文件

一旦获取到js文件后,我们可以通过动态创建`script`标签来执行这个js文件。

```markdown
```javascript
axios.get('
  .then(response => {
    const script = document.createElement('script');
    script.innerText = response.data;
    document.body.appendChild(script);
  })
  .catch(error => {
    console.error('加载js文件失败', error);
  });

## 示例

下面是一个简单的示例,演示如何使用axios加载一个js文件并执行该文件:

```markdown
```javascript
axios.get('
  .then(response => {
    const script = document.createElement('script');
    script.innerText = response.data;
    document.body.appendChild(script);
  })
  .catch(error => {
    console.error('加载js文件失败', error);
  });

## 流程图

```mermaid
flowchart TD
   A[发送axios请求获取js文件] --> B[获取到js文件]
   B --> C[执行js文件]

旅行图

journey
    title 使用axios加载js文件
    section 步骤一
        A(发送axios请求获取js文件) --> B(获取到js文件)
    section 步骤二
        B --> C(执行js文件)

通过上面的步骤,我们可以使用axios加载js文件并执行该文件。这种方式可以帮助我们动态加载js文件,实现更加灵活的前端开发。希望本文对您有所帮助!


https://www.xamrdz.com/web/2jh1962045.html

相关文章: